Honeycrisp Bloom Time. Honeycrisp trees take two to eight years to produce their first apples depending on their size. The best pollinators for a ‘honeycrisp’ apple tree are apple varieties that bloom at the same time and are not triploid. ‘honeycrisp’ trees mature in about six years, but they’ll start to produce well before that. The trees seem to do best when trained to a central leader, so some staking will be required for the first few years. Honeycrisp apple trees typically bloom between late march and early may, with blooming time influenced by regional climate.
